Abstract

The present disclosure provides a control method for a user identification card, which is applied to a terminal, wherein the terminal comprises: a first subscriber identity SIM card and a second SIM card, the method comprising: acquiring function setting information of the second SIM card; when the function setting information indicates that the second SIM card enters a limited state, allowing the second SIM card to execute a first function and prohibiting the second SIM card from executing a second function under the condition that the first SIM card is allowed to execute all functions; the second function is different from the first function. According to the embodiment of the disclosure, the second SIM card is allowed to execute the first function, so that the use requirement of a user on the first function of the second SIM card can be met, and meanwhile, the radio frequency resources occupied by the second SIM card can be reduced by prohibiting the second SIM card from executing the second function, so that the phenomenon of blocking of data services provided by the first SIM card due to the fact that the second SIM card occupies the radio frequency resources is reduced, and the data service experience of the user is improved.

Background
Two identification cards (a main card and an auxiliary card) are usually installed in the dual-card terminal equipment, wherein the main card is mainly used for data service, the auxiliary card is mainly used for voice and short message service, and the main card and the auxiliary card share a set of radio frequency resources.
The requirements for terminal performance are high in a game scene, so that the use of radio frequency resources by the auxiliary card needs to be reduced as much as possible. The communication of the auxiliary card occupies radio frequency resources, so that the time delay of the data service of the main card is larger, and the game application which utilizes the main card to carry out the data service can be blocked, thereby seriously affecting the user experience.
In the related art, in order to avoid the phenomenon of blocking the game application caused by answering the phone through the sub-card, some terminals directly provide the option of disabling the sub-card to the user, however, if the user selects to disable the sub-card, important phone missed calls may be caused, and if the user selects to not disable the sub-card, no optimization is provided at all.

Next, a control method of the user identification card provided in the embodiment of the present disclosure is further described with reference to fig. 5 to 6.
The embodiment of the disclosure provides a control method of a user identity identification card, which is applied to a terminal, and the terminal comprises a main card (namely a first SIM card in the embodiment) and a sub card (namely a second SIM card in the embodiment), and by providing a plurality of levels of measures for users to select, balance is made between limiting the sub card and reserving key capability of the sub card, and even if the users do not sacrifice the capability of fully reserving the sub card, a certain degree of optimization can be made, so that the power consumption can be reduced, the occupation of wireless resources can be reduced, and the game katon and the like caused by the fact that the sub card occupies network resources can be reduced.
As shown in fig. 5, the control method of the user identification card specifically includes the following steps:
s1, entering a game mode;
s2, determining whether a user allows setting of the sub-card call transfer according to the function setting information of the pre-stored sub-card, if so, executing the step S3, and if not, executing the step S6;
s3, setting the call transfer of the auxiliary card to the main card according to the function setting information of the auxiliary card;
s4, determining whether the user allows the auxiliary card to be disabled according to the function setting information of the auxiliary card, if so, executing the step S5, and if not, executing the step S9;
S5, disabling the auxiliary card;
s6, determining whether the user agrees to close the high-definition voice call VoLTE according to the function setting information of the auxiliary card, if so, executing the step S10, and if not, executing the step S7;
s7, determining whether VoLTE is available, if so, executing a step S8, and if not, executing a step S11;
s8, determining whether the user allows refusing to receive the incoming call of the auxiliary card according to the function setting information of the auxiliary card, if so, executing the step S9, and if not, executing the step S12;
s9, setting the auxiliary card to reject all paging messages;
s10, closing VoLTE, and after the step S10, executing the step S11;
s11, setting a sub card to reject PS domain paging information;
s12, setting the auxiliary card to reject the CS domain paging message, and executing step S13 after the step S12;
s13, controlling the auxiliary card to reject the garbage bag.
As shown in fig. 6, the sub-card rejecting waste bag in the step S13 may include the following steps:
s131, receiving the paging message of the network side and analyzing the paging message of the sub card of the current equipment to the PS domain;
s132, sending a request for establishing RRC connection to a network side through a secondary card;
s133, after the auxiliary card establishes RRC connection with the network side, acquiring the bearer information issued by the network side from a radio bearer establishment request of the network side;
S134, determining whether the service type to which the paging message paging the auxiliary card belongs is data service or not according to the bearing information; if yes, go to step S136, if no, go to step S135;
s135, determining the service type of the paging message is VoLTE service, and responding to the paging message.
S136, the paging message is ignored or discarded as junk information; after the step S136 is performed, a step S137 is performed;
s137, disconnecting the data service corresponding access point (AccessPointName, APN) of the auxiliary card.
As can be seen from the above, the control method of the user identification card provided by the embodiment of the present disclosure has at least the following advantages:
1. the influence of the auxiliary card activity on the game in the game process is reduced, and better experience is brought to the user.
2. And providing multiple layers of options for users to select, so as to meet the requirements of different degrees.
3. By reducing the activity of the secondary card, more resources can be released and the power consumption can be reduced.
4. The control of the SIM card is realized on software, so that the hardware cost is not consumed;
5. the terminal side algorithm is supplemented and does not depend on a specific platform.
